2. RIJKSMUSEUM

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(2)RIJKSMUSEUM

An Amsterdam Tourist Attraction which cannot be missed is a visit to the historical Rijksmuseum in Museum Square which is home to many beautiful and renowned artifacts.

This museum has artifacts of great significance and importance since the 13th Century with more than a million artifacts being there. Its beautiful construction started after Pierre Cuypers design won an award and it was opened in 1885.
Some of its famous works include the paintings by Johannes Vemeer, Rembrandt and many more. You would not mind paying for entry here when you get to see ‘Night Watch’, Rembrandts famous masterpiece.

3. VAN GOGH MUSEUM

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(3)

House to the letters and paintings of Van Goghis one of Amsterdam’s Tourist Attractions that cannot go unnoticed. His artwork is chronologically displayed to give an insight into his vivid style. His work is displayed in a four story building designed by Gerrit Rietveld.

The different floors have different styles and showcase more than 200 paintings, his struggles in life and the great efforts taken to restore his work and also works of artists like Millet, Daubingy and Gaugin.

4. BEGIJNHOF

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(4)

This Amsterdam attraction is the central location in Amsterdam which occupies the central land area in the canal system. This district has historical importance and goes way back to the 14th century where sisters of Catholic Beguines resided.

Not a convent in the traditional sense as sisters had the liberty to leave if they wished to get married. Begijnhop Kapel is a wonderful structure with beautiful marble columns, stained glass windows and beautiful architecture. An English Reformed Church is also one of Amsterdam’s attractions. An old wooden house from 1465 is also located here.

5. ANNE FRANK HOUSE

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(5)

A visit to theAnne Frank Houseone of the attractions in Amsterdam which portrays the life of Anne Frank, a girl who along with few other families had to face a lot of hardships by being trapped in this house for around 2 years. They were hiding in hear from the cruelty of the Nazi Authorities during the Second World War. The Anne Frank House is now made a museum for travelers to feel and see closely how they managed to survive here.

This place became of importance after her father published Anne’s diary which had facts and incidents about their life in the hidden building. You can experience and get to know of her life by visiting this house.

7. VONDELPARK

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(7)

Looking to spend a nice day with good food, music and chilled beer with your loved ones with a serene view than the Vondelpark named after the famous Dutch poet Joost Van Den Vondel is the place to visit.

Earlier known as the Nieuwe Park in 1865, this place got its name as Vondelpark after the statue of the 17th century writer and poet was placed here. Louis Royer is the famous designer and sculptor who made this beautiful statue. Do spend a day relaxing and enjoying the beauty here.

8. SCHEEPVAART MUSEUM

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(8)

A Maritime Museum known as Scheepvaart museum holds and showcases artifacts of the Dutch Navy. In earlier times it was a storehouse of the navy which had around 18 rooms with various artifacts. Sea Trade was amongst one of the main forte of the Dutch making them one of the wealthiest cities in the 1600s.

This multi storey museum depicts the historical sea battles, the weapons used and the maps used drawn in artistic manner. A beautiful replica of the famous ship ‘Amsterdam’ of the 18th century is anchored outside the museum.

10. KONINKLIJK PALEIS AMSTERDAM

Top 10 Most Visited Attractions In Amsterdam (10)

The western vicinity of the Dam Square showcases this awe inspiring architecture. The records of this magnificent architecture chart its way from being the City Town Hall to a palace where Napolean’s brother Louis was christened as King Louis I of Holland.

The famous builder Jacob van Campen constructed the palace with a sandstone exterior so as to lend it a Public buildings touch of Roman era, the interiors however exult the royal aura of the 1800’s empire style.
